Kushner Used Private Email Account

Senior White House advisor and son-in-law to President Trump, Jared Kushner, used a private email account for communication with officials within the administration, according to CNN .

Politico reported that Kushner’s account was set up in December and was used to speak to officials and advisors about media coverage, event planning, and other subjects.

"Mr. Kushner uses his White House email address to conduct White House business," Abbe Lowell, Kushner’s lawyer, said in a statement. "Fewer than a hundred emails from January through August were either sent to or returned by Mr. Kushner to colleagues in the White House from his personal email account."

During the campaign last year, Donald Trump continually attacked Hillary Clinton about a private email of her own.

The White House has not made a comment regarding Kushner.
